Methadone maintenance is a form of treatment for clients in New Castle who are addicted to heroin or prescription opioid medications. This type of treatment has been around for a very long time, and the overall notion is that clients are no longer wrapped up in the drug abusing activities that was caused by their addiction since the methadone they are taking satisfies cravings and prevents withdrawal. Similar to heroin, methadone is a full opioid agonist and activates the same neural receptors in the brain as heroin and other powerful pain killers. This is what makes methadone so powerful as a substitute for heroin and other prescription opioids.
Patients involved in methadone maintenance have to dose every day to avoid withdrawal from the methadone itself. This might be financially and logistically burdensome, but some find it a better choice than a heroin addiction. However, someone beginning methadone maintenance should be aware of the fact that methadone detoxification is considered far more challenging than even heroin detox and withdrawal. Once taking a high dosage of methadone, there are some detoxification facilities that will not take methadone maintenance clients since detoxification can be very challenging and relapse rates are considerably high.
